Ngữ pháp

Past tense issue

× Yes, I had. I had a bike when I was a child.

Yes, I did. I had a bike when I was a child.

The short answer to a past simple question uses the auxiliary did, not the main verb had. Saying 'Yes, I had.' repeats the main verb and sounds unnatural. Use 'Yes, I did.' for a concise response and keep 'I had a bike when I was a child.' as the full sentence. Suggestion: respond with 'Yes, I did.' or simply 'I had a bike when I was a child.' to be grammatically correct.

Incorrect use of words / Incorrect use of adjectives or adverbs

× Yes, I think mice are popular in my country because it's cheap cheap.

Yes, I think bikes are popular in my country because they are cheap.

The student used 'mice' instead of 'bikes' (word choice error) and repeated 'cheap' which is ungrammatical. Also, 'it’s cheap' refers to a singular subject; 'bikes' is plural so use 'they are cheap.' Suggestion: use the correct noun 'bikes' and match the verb/ pronoun to plural: 'they are cheap.' Avoid repeating adjectives unnecessarily.
